NURS 400 - Introduction to Nursing Research3 Credits
This course introduces students to general principles and concepts related to the research process in nursing practice and theory. Emphasis is given to: the role of the professional nurse as a consumer of research; expanding decision-making through the use of research findings; evaluating the usefulness of research findings for current practice.
Prerequisite(s): PSYC 204 or MATH 240; NURS 348 and NURS 349. Lecture
